Product Description:
Basic chromic sulfate is a dark - green or brownish - black, hygroscopic powder. It is soluble in water, forming solutions with a characteristic green color. Chemically, it contains chromium in a +3 oxidation state, along with sulfate anions and hydroxide groups. In the leather - tanning industry, it is an essential tanning agent. It reacts with the collagen in animal hides, forming stable cross - links that transform the raw hides into durable leather. This process not only improves the mechanical properties of the leather but also makes it resistant to decay. In the textile industry, basic chromic sulfate can be used as a mordant in dyeing processes. It helps fix dyes to the fabric, enhancing the color fastness and ensuring that the colors remain vivid and long - lasting. In the manufacturing of certain pigments, it serves as a raw material. The chromium in the compound contributes to the formation of pigments with unique colors and properties. In the chemical industry, it can be involved in some redox reactions and is used in the synthesis of other chromium - containing compounds. However, basic chromic sulfate should be handled with extreme care. Chromium compounds, especially those in the +6 oxidation state which can be formed under certain conditions from basic chromic sulfate, are known to be toxic and carcinogenic. Avoid inhalation of its dust, and direct skin and eye contact should be prevented. It should be stored in a tightly - sealed container, in a dry and well - ventilated area, away from incompatible substances to prevent any potential chemical reactions and to ensure safe storage.
